## Building Access — Intern Cohort Week

The autumn intern cohort joins Pellgrove Systems on Monday and will be based on Level 3 of the Ashwick building. Interns receive temporary badges on day one, but these take up to 48 hours to activate on the turnstiles, so new starters should expect to escort them through the side gate in the meantime. Escorts must sign the gate log each time. The side gate keypad accepts the code below.

door code, bahap-yahaf: bdg-Q-02

### Runbook: ReceiptRelay mailer stuck

Symptoms: donation receipts queueing, no sends, queue depth alert fires.

First: check the SMTP relay health endpoint. If healthy, the mailer worker is probably wedged on a malformed template — restart the worker pool, not the whole service. If unhealthy, fail over to the secondary relay and page the infra rotation. Do not replay the dead-letter queue until dedupe is confirmed on, or donors get duplicate receipts. Verify the service is running with the following configuration values.

config for kajeg-bafop:
[julael]
host = julael.plorvadata.corp
user = julael_svc
database = julael_prod

Subject: Handover — VramScope release duties

Hi Tannik,

Taking over from me on VramScope, our GPU memory profiling tool. Releases cut every other Thursday from the stable branch; the profiler agent and the dashboard ship together. CI on Brindlewock handles builds, but you must sign the agent binary manually before publishing. Docs live in the repo wiki. The signing key for the agent binary is below.

rollout seal: bky9_dKu6BZbvE